As sales of electric vehicles (EVs) rise in New Jersey, so do taxes on residents. Earlier this year, Gov. Phil Murphy (D-N.J.) signed a phaseout on the sales tax exemption for zero-emission EVs.
New Jersey imposes a 6.625% state sales tax. Localities can add an additional 2%. However, the average local and combined sales tax rate is only 6.60%, according to the Tax Foundation.
